Abstract

The embodiment of the invention discloses electronic equipment. The electronic equipment comprises a radio frequency integrated circuit, a multi-path radio frequency path, multiple diversion paths, aswitch device and an antenna, wherein each multi-path radio frequency path is connected with the radio frequency integrated circuit, the switch device is arranged between the multi-path radio frequency and the multiple diversion paths and is used for selecting the radio frequency path connected with the diversion paths, and the antenna is connected with the multiple diversion paths and is used forsupporting wireless signal transceiving of at least two frequency bands.

Description

technical field [0001] The present invention relates to the technical field of communication, in particular to an electronic device. Background technique [0002] With the development of communication technology, many communication devices have multiple antennas, and these antennas can send and receive wireless signals in different frequency bands. In the prior art, due to the multi-antenna design, these antennas need to achieve resonance through impedance matching.
